Factor IX protein, although present in a very low concentration in plasma,
is essential for hemostasis. Patients with congenital deficiency of factor
IX, hemophilia B, have a bleeding disorder with a prevalence of 5 per
100,000 males. These patients require an inordinate supply of donor blood
products to control their bleeding and thus lead nearly normal lives.
Acquired factor IX defects are uncommon by themselves but accompany the
depression of other vitamin K-dependent clotting factors in liver disease
and in patients on oral anticoagulants. Management of bleeding in the
acquired defects is much more difficult.
In order to function in clotting, factor IX must be converted to an active
form, factor IXa. Just how this occurs either normally or pathologically
is poorly understood as are the means of limiting its activity. Since
factor IX activation is one of the initial steps of a long series of
biochemical reactions which lead to clotting, it provides excellent
potential for either setting off or controlling the very common disorders
of thrombosis. A greater understanding of interactions between this plasma
protein, blood platelets (the clotting cells) and the innner walls of the
blood vessels is needed.
It is proposed that elucidating the functional abnormalities and structural
bases of hemophilic (abnormal) factor IX proteins will provide insights
into the role of this clotting protein in normal blood clotting and
thrombosis. Antibody techniques to purify abnormal factor IX proteins from
patients' plasmas are being developed. The abnormal factor IX proteins
will be labeled with a trace of radioactivity and studied by sensitive
immunochemical methods. Characterization will include micro-screening
tests for: 1) their ability to be converted from an inactive precursor to
the active form, 2) their ability to be broken down by certain enzymes, 3)
their functional properties as enzymes and 4) their interactions with
cofactors. We will also be able to assess for unstable variants which are
cleared more rapidly than normal from the circulation. Studies of
hemophilic factor IX genes will be used to determine what is wrong with the
structure of a given hemophilic factor IX protein by identifying the
abnormality in the genetic code.
